White Chocolate Walnut Raisin Biscotti.

Ingredients of White Chocolate Walnut Raisin Biscotti
- Prepare 1 cup of Walnuts -.
- It’s 2 cups of Flour -.
- You need 1 tsp of Baking Powder -.
- Prepare 1/8 tsp of Salt -.
- Prepare 1/2 cup of Raisins -.
- Prepare 3/4 cups of Sugar -.
- Prepare 3 of Eggs -.
- You need 1 tsp of Vanilla Extract -.
White Chocolate Walnut Raisin Biscotti step by step
- Toast Walnuts in a preheated 180C/350F oven until lightly brown for 8-10mins.
- Reduce the temperature to 150C/300F and began to make the dough.
- Beat the eggs and the extracts together. Slowly add in the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t. Mix until blended into a dough. Add the walnuts and raisins and gently fold in to the dough.
- Roll the dough into a log and place on a baking sheet and bake for 30-40mins or until firm to touch.
- Remove from oven, and let it cool for about 10mins. Using a knife, cut the log into 1/2 inch slices. Place the slices on the baking sheet and bake for 10mins, turn the slices over and bake another 10mins until firm to the touch.
- I then melted some white chocolate and dipped each into it 🙂 YUM!.
- Remove from oven and let it cool. Store in an airtight container.
